AMERICAN LEGION POST #593, founded in 1933, is a micro nonprofit that reported $74K in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ue surged 52%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$30K, a strong 40% operating margin.

Mission

PAST/PRESENT MEMBERS OF ARMED FORCES. PROVIDE SOCIAL RECREATIONAL, AND BENELOVENCE FOR MEMBERS AND COMMUNITY
